Dictionary: bod   (bŏd) pronunciation
n. Slang
  1. The physical human body; build: "likes brainy men who maintain a good bod" (Catherine Breslin).
  2. A person: "When his ancient tank had broken down . . . he had jumped on the back of mine with a few other bods" (Robert Crisp).

The noun has one meaning:

Meaning #1: alternative names for the body of a human being
  Synonyms: human body, physical body, material body, soma, build, figure, physique, anatomy, shape, chassis, frame, form, flesh
